HELPING YOU BE WELL IN BODY, MIND, AND SPIRIT

Sharing Mother Nature's inspiration and nourishment from my garden with this morning's autumn harvest in West Gippsland, Australia ...

I recognise that we have to know how to use what we grow, so I want to support you to be comfortable with simple ways of well-being with this food:
❤️ Chilli and tomato provide pungency and raise digestive fire. Use these nightshades sparingly if your body naturally burns hot. Deseed and add to stir fries, braises, casseroles. Use tomato in salad or stews.
❤️Parsley can be chopped up and used as garnish or as greens. Mint is lovely chopped up in salads or added to drinks of water. Rosemary can be added as a few sprigs to braises, stews, and casseroles.
❤️Makrut lime zest and leaves add complex freshness and flavour to asian-inspired stir fries and steamed dishes. It is quite strong and works well in chutneys too.
❤️Lemons are a healing addition as juice in hot water, or using zest, peel, or juice in food for a burst of sour sunshine. It is important for clearing lung congestion and supporting good digestion.
❤️Silverbeet is wonderful chopped up and lightly steamed as greens or added to stir fries and vegetable stews. You can use it as a replacement for spinach too.
❤️ Mesclun (mixed lettuce leaves) are a lovely salad base. Tatsoi can be added to stir fries.
❤️ Fig is best eaten fresh off the tree. Rhubarb stems can be chopped up and baked or stewed with a little water. Add a little honey, cinnamon, vanilla, maple syrup, or palm sugar to sweeten rhubarb as it is sour and astringent (do not use the toxic leaves). It is lovely used with stewed apple in a baked crumble.

I trust this provides some helpful ideas for growing and cooking these foods. Nurturing ourselves naturally with all five senses is worth it! We just have to try and practise. Affordable good eating is about quality not quantity - we really do not need much fresh, seasonal, natural wholefood for the size of our stomach.

In support of to empower choosing and using a predominance of natural plant-based nourishment.

AYURVEDA
I appreciate and celebrate “our daily herbs” for the holistic, medicinal nutrition they provide. Pictured here from my family’s autumn garden are borage, sage, bay leaf, aloe vera, peppermint geranium, rosemary, lemon balm, Tulsi, echinacea, comfrey, flat leaf parsley, mint, peppermint, Baby Sun Rose, Gotu Kola, thyme, curly leaf parsley, marjoram, winter savory. I use them all in various ways for either food, herbal tea, topical medicine, or beautifying our house and garden. Variety for permaculture reasons offers balance and interwoven relationship and support of our ornamental and food plants. Herbs and medicinal plants should be used carefully with knowledge and intention, although some culinary herbs such as parsley, thyme, and marjoram are okay used in quantity. I find sage is good used in a steam bowl for cool weather nasal and lung congestion. Herbs are powerful allies for our holistic health and we can appreciate and use them simply, including to nourish our senses and use them as a cut plant in a vase (like I do with lemon balm to lift my mood indoors).
